    So, I don't know if this is in support or criticism on the OP, but...

    Theres a lot of math behind rating systems. Trueskill is one variant that focuses on skill-appropriate-matchups, while ELO grants a more "competitive" approach, but doesn't really help with matchup-generation. For a multi-platform all-demographic game, trueskill just makes more sense as it allows for a better "pickup and play" game experience (thus why microsoft makes it available for xbox games). Unfortunately, ELO doesn't really help you much with matchmaking - its just abstracting pure "skill" - which isn't a very good mathematical model for rankings in a "casual" game.

    The microsoft white paper goes into detail about how trueskill creates better matchmaking, but has incongruities at the high and low levels. Personally, I think without the massive player-base of something like Call of Duty, those disparities are amplified (thus the ability to get "stuck" at a rating bracket, exacerbated by the rating decay).

    I think Wulven is looking to the tournament system to fill this niche, and I'm guessing they will implement a corresponding "tournament rating" which better rewards "skill" in the abstract.
